I graduated from the University of Derby with a BSc in Psychology and kind of fell into statistics when I joined the Department for Work and Pensions. I didn't even know that being a statistician was a career option for me. Data is powerful and held a fascination for me. Once I started working as a Higher Information Analyst in 2006, I never looked back.

Working here has meant working with some of the biggest, most comprehensive healthcare datasets out there.

We have such a supportive culture here.

During the pandemic, I worked on creating the Shielded Patients List, COVID-19 vaccine cohorts and on getting researchers the GP data they needed to understand the virus’s impact and treatment. It has been a hugely exciting period to be working on NHS data – and it came as a bit of a cherry on top to win ‘Data Leader of the Year’ award at the Women in IT awards  last year.
